diff --git a/gtk2_ardour/plugin_pin_dialog.cc b/gtk2_ardour/plugin_pin_dialog.cc index aa04b5cd02..108f1f2b8a 100644 --- a/gtk2_ardour/plugin_pin_dialog.cc +++ b/gtk2_ardour/plugin_pin_dialog.cc @@ -2147,8 +2147,11 @@ PluginPinDialog::map_height (Gtk::Allocation&) } void -PluginPinDialog::route_processors_changed (ARDOUR::RouteProcessorChange) +PluginPinDialog::route_processors_changed (ARDOUR::RouteProcessorChange c) { + if (c.type == RouteProcessorChange::CustomPinChange) { + return; + } ppw.clear (); _height_mapped = false; scroller->remove ();